在处理“mysql 数据库时间少了8小时”问题,我们需要理解这个问题背景,采取系统分析和解决方案。mysql 服务器时间不准确通常会导致数据不一致,影响业务逻辑和数据分析。因此,找到正确解决方案显得尤为重要。 ## 背景定位 在企业级应用中,数据库时间同步对于数据准确性及一致性至关重要。比如说,一些实时数据分析系统可能依赖于准确时间戳来保证数据正确性。 适用场景分析如下:
原创 6月前
27阅读
文章目录问题解决步骤:1.数据库时间问题,与时区有关2.Java时间问题,返回时间json格式不对冷知识-多个时区概念理解Asia/Shanghai与GMT+8区别 数据库时间字段create_time datetime 创建时间问题前端发现创建时间与当前系统时间相差8小时,查看数据库时间也是与当前系统相差8小时解决步骤:1.数据库时间问题,与时区有关方式一:改变Java连接数据库url修
mysql时间不对(时区问题)在mysql手册中有下面这段话:5.10.8. MySQL服务器时区支持MySQL服务器有几个区设置:·         系统时区。服务器启动便试图确定主机时区,用它来设置system_time_zone系统变量。·     &nb
# MySQL数据库插入时间少了8小时解决方案 作为一名经验丰富开发者,我很高兴能帮助刚入行小白解决“MySQL数据库插入时间少了8小时问题。这个问题通常发生在时区设置不正确情况下。下面,我将详细解释整个解决流程,并提供相应代码示例。 ## 解决流程 首先,我们来看一下解决这个问题整体流程: | 步骤 | 描述 | | --- | --- | | 1 | 检查MySQL服务
原创 2024-07-22 03:56:44
271阅读
# 如何解决MySQL时间少了8小时问题 ## 简介 MySQL是一种常用关系型数据库管理系统,用于存储和管理数据。在使用MySQL过程中,偶尔会遇到时间少了8小时问题,这是因为MySQL默认采用时区是UTC(协调世界),而不是我们所在地本地时区。本文将指导你从头到尾解决这个问题,并提供每一步具体代码和解释。 ## 解决流程 下面是解决MySQL时间少了8小时问题步骤,我们将
原创 2023-08-17 14:03:26
411阅读
# MySQL 8 插入数据库少了 8 小时处理指南 在处理时间和时区问题数据库记录可能会出现时间偏差。此文将指导你如何将插入到 MySQL 8 时间减少 8 小时。我们以实现插入数据时间为 UTC+8 为例,以下是整个流程。 ## 处理流程 | 步骤 | 描述 | |------|-----------
原创 2024-10-31 08:31:56
64阅读
# MySQL时间处理:解决“时间少了8小时问题 ## 1. 问题概述 在使用MySQL数据库,很多初学者会遇到一个常见问题:从数据库中查询时间与实际时间存在8小时差异。这种情况通常是因为时区设置不正确导致。为了帮助你理解如何解决这个问题,本文将细化这个步骤,并提供必要代码示例。 ## 2. 解决流程 我们将通过以下步骤来解决时间差异问题: | 步骤 | 描述
原创 2024-09-11 04:21:10
601阅读
### 解决Java用MyBatis存到数据库时间少了8小时问题 作为一名经验丰富开发者,你需要帮助一位刚入行小白解决一个问题:在使用Java和MyBatis将数据存入数据库时间会相差8小时。本文将引导你一步一步解决这个问题,并提供详细代码和注释。 #### 问题分析 首先我们需要明确问题本质。在Java中,时间通常以UTC(协调世界形式存储,而数据库中通常存储是本地
原创 2023-11-10 12:21:24
649阅读
在这篇文章里,我将讨论在MySQL 5.7里如何使用InnoDB缓冲池预加载特性。从MySQL 5.6开始,可以配置MySQL保存InnoDB缓存池数据,并在启动加载。在MySQL 5.7后,这是默认行为。在默认配置中,MySQL保存和恢复缓存池一部分,不再需要任何特殊配置。我们在Percona Server 5.6中提供了一个类似的功能,所以这个概念已经存在了相当长时间。坦率来说,时间
最近好几个社区用户咨询,错误执行了 dropDatabse 把数据库误删除了(或 dropCollection 误删集合),有什么方法能恢复数据?本文主要介绍几种可能有效恢复方案。方案1:通过备份集恢复如果对 MongoDB 做了全量备份 + 增量备份,那么可以通过备份集及来恢复数据。备份可以是多种形式,比如通过 mongodump 等工具,对数据库产生逻辑备份拷贝 dbpath 目录产生
转载 2023-08-20 15:10:29
108阅读
最近在用mybatis发现,将LocalDateTime插入到数据库时间少了8小时。 用网上其他方法试了不少,比如修改mysql时区,都不能解决。最后发现是JDBC连接参数写错了。
转载 2021-07-27 15:55:33
2312阅读
# MySQL 数据插入时处理时区问题 在实际开发过程中,我们经常会面临时间和日期处理问题。当我们插入数据MySQL 数据库,有时会发现插入时间比实际时间少了8小时。这通常是因为时区设置问题。本文将为你详细讲解如何解决这个问题,同时举例说明如何在 MySQL 中正确插入带有时区时间数据。 ## 整体流程 首先我们需要明确整个操作流程,下面是一个简单流程表: | 步骤
原创 11月前
111阅读
1.创建scrapy命令scrapy startproject 项目名称2.创建爬虫文件        2.1:cd spider2022        2.2: scrapy genspider 爬虫文件名  爬网站域名  3.通过PyCharm软件打开爬虫项目 4.爬取 h
1 oracle对时间格式数据存贮oracle数据库中存放时间格式数据,是以oracle特定格式存贮,占7个字节,与查询显示时间格式无关。存贮时间包括年•月•日••分•秒,最小精度为秒,不存贮秒以下时间单位。因此在一些前台支持毫秒级程序(如PB客户端程序)连接到oracle数据库应注意这点。2 oracle时间显示格式   通常,客户端与数据库建立起连接后
转载 1月前
413阅读
## 解决tdsql mysqldump导入数据库时间少了8小时问题 在数据库管理中,有时候会遇到导入数据库时间少了8小时问题,这通常是由于时区设置不正确导致。特别是在使用tdsql mysqldump导入数据库,由于时区设置差异,可能会导致时间偏差。下面我们将介绍如何解决这个问题。 ### 时区设置 在MySQL中,时区是一个非常重要概念。MySQL数据库有自己默认
原创 2024-06-06 05:19:39
99阅读
# 如何实现mysql数据库时间8小时 ## 1. 流程图 ```mermaid stateDiagram [*] --> 开始 开始 --> 查询数据库 查询数据库 --> 更新时间 更新时间 --> [*] ``` ## 2. 具体步骤 | 步骤 | 操作 | | :---: | :--- | | 1 | 连接到数据库 | | 2 | 查询数据库
原创 2024-07-04 04:39:31
233阅读
# MySQL数据库时间晚了8小时 ## 引言 在开发和使用MySQL数据库,我们可能会遇到数据库时间晚了8小时情况。这可能会导致数据不准确,影响我们对数据分析和决策。本文将介绍为什么会发生这种情况,以及如何解决这个问题。 ## 问题原因 MySQL数据库是一个很受欢迎关系型数据库管理系统,它使用系统时区设置来处理日期和时间。而问题通常出现在操作系统时区设置和MySQL服务器
原创 2023-09-18 12:51:57
508阅读
讲解这次做项目的时候使用回了laravel8 版本 但是好巧不巧,发现不是输出格式有问题就是输出时间不准确问题解决方案问题一输出时间格式没有序列化;如图所示解决方案如果采用代码中格式输出方式很繁琐以后每次写代码时候我们都需要格式化一下时间然后再输出,这个时候我们可以采用laravel提供修改器统一格式化输出时间在对应模型中使用修改器//不知道修改器如何使用可以查阅官方文档   
转载 2021-05-08 10:41:40
1215阅读
2评论
# MySQL存入数据少了8小时原因及解决方案 在现代应用中,时间管理是一个重要而复杂问题,尤其是在涉及跨时区应用时。我们在使用MySQL数据库,可能会遇到一个常见问题:存入数据库时间数据比预期少了8小时。这种情况通常是由于时区设置不当或处理不当导致。 ## 问题分析 在MySQL中,时间类型(如 `DATETIME` 和 `TIMESTAMP`)存储和显示,常常受
原创 11月前
513阅读
# 如何解决“docker run 时间少了8小时问题 在使用 Docker 过程中,可能会遇到一些与时间相关问题,例如 Docker 容器时间显示与主机不一致,常常是因为时区设置不当。本文将指导你如何调整 Docker 容器时区,以解决“docker run 时间少了8小时问题,并确保容器和主机时间一致。我们将以下面的流程来进行: | 步骤 | 说明
原创 2024-08-03 05:08:50
81阅读
  • 1
  • 2
  • 3
  • 4
  • 5